About this earthquake

On April 6, 2026 at 02:18 UTC, a magnitude M3.1 earthquake occurred near WYOMING. With a focal depth of about 12 km, this was a shallow earthquake, whose shaking is usually felt more strongly at the surface. Earthquakes of this magnitude are often felt but rarely cause damage.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
